The year 2025 is set to mark a significant milestone in the field of advanced robotics, with companies worldwide unveiling their next-generation humanoid robots. From Tesla’s versatile Optimus Gen 2 to Engineered Arts’ lifelike Ameca, these robots offer a wide array of applications, from industrial automation to social interactions. This guide explores 12 of the leading humanoids, highlighting their distinctive features and key specifications to help you understand how these robots are shaping the future.
1. Tesla – Optimus Gen 2
Tesla’s Optimus Gen 2 is the latest iteration of its versatile robotics platform. Designed to assist with both industrial and household tasks, this robot incorporates Tesla's cutting-edge AI alongside their expert engineering.
Overview: Optimus Gen 2 showcases enhanced joint mobility and a streamlined design compared to its predecessor. It is capable of handling repetitive tasks, supporting manufacturing processes, and even performing home automation functions, all while continuously learning from real-world interactions.
Key Metrics:
-
Height: Approximately 5’8” (1.73 m)
-
Weight: Around 125 lbs (57 kg)
-
Degrees of Freedom: Improved joint flexibility for accurate manipulation
-
Primary Use: Industrial assistance and home automation
-
Estimated Price: ~$30,000
2. Boston Dynamics – Electric Atlas
Boston Dynamics’ Electric Atlas is a high-performance humanoid robot designed for dynamic movement in tough environments. Known for its acrobatic abilities, this robot excels in agility and balance.
Overview: Electric Atlas can perform complex actions such as running, jumping, and executing precise moves like backflips. It is ideal for applications in search and rescue, industrial inspections, and research.
Key Metrics:
-
Height: Approximately 1.5 m
-
Weight: About 75 kg
-
Capabilities: Exceptional agility and balance, including dynamic movement
-
Primary Use: Industrial inspections, search and rescue, research
-
Unique Feature: Advanced electric actuators for precise movement control
3. Unitree Robotics – G1
The G1 from Unitree Robotics is designed to offer a mix of agility, cost-effectiveness, and practical performance. It’s intended to serve industries and research environments where efficient, compact robots are necessary.
Overview: The G1 is engineered for rapid, agile movement, focusing on operational efficiency and easy deployment in service sectors.
Key Metrics:
-
Height: Approximately 1.4 m
-
Weight: Estimated at 40–50 kg
-
Battery Life: 2–3 hours of continuous operation
-
Primary Use: Logistics automation and service industry applications
-
Design Focus: Agile and affordable robotic performance
4. Agility Robotics – Digit
Agility Robotics’ Digit is famous for its human-like walking ability and dynamic mobility. Designed to navigate urban environments, it is ideal for logistics and delivery tasks.
Overview: Digit features a robust bipedal gait, allowing it to traverse complex surfaces and overcome obstacles. It is engineered for tasks requiring speed and precision.
Key Metrics:
-
Height: Approximately 1.2 m
-
Weight: About 30 kg
-
Payload Capacity: Up to 15 kg
-
Battery Life: Roughly 4 hours of continuous operation
-
Primary Use: Urban navigation and logistics
5. Apptronik – Apollo
Apollo from Apptronik is an industrial humanoid robot built for heavy-duty tasks. Focused on precision and efficiency, Apollo is designed to assist with complex manufacturing workflows.
Overview: Apollo blends robust hardware with sophisticated AI to carry out intricate tasks on factory floors. It is capable of handling heavy lifting and precision tasks, making it a versatile asset in industrial settings.
Key Metrics:
-
Height: Approximately 1.7 m
-
Weight: Around 60 kg
-
Degrees of Freedom: 28+ joints for refined motion control
-
Battery Life: Estimated at 5 hours per charge
-
Primary Use: Industrial automation and manufacturing
6. NEURA Robotics – 4NE-1
NEURA Robotics' 4NE-1 is a next-gen humanoid robot designed for seamless human-robot interaction. Combining advanced AI with cutting-edge sensor technology, it excels in dynamic environments, providing reliable performance across a wide range of tasks.
Overview: The 4NE-1 is equipped with state-of-the-art 3D vision, tactile feedback, and multi-modal interaction systems, enabling it to adapt intuitively to its surroundings. Whether assisting with household chores or handling complex industrial operations, it offers consistent performance in both domestic and industrial settings.
Key Metrics:
-
Primary Use: Domestic, service, and industrial applications
-
Height: 1.8 m
-
Weight: 80 kg
-
Payload Capacity: 15 kg
-
Capabilities: Cognitive processing and adaptive movement
7. 1X – NEO BETA
NEO BETA by 1X is a sophisticated humanoid designed for precision in industrial environments. Its innovative design optimizes manufacturing processes with exceptional dexterity.
Overview: NEO BETA integrates strength and agility, making it perfect for assembly and automation. It features multiple joints, providing flexibility for performing complex operations.
Key Metrics:
-
Height: Approximately 1.6 m
-
Weight: Around 70 kg
-
Degrees of Freedom: 24+ joints for enhanced dexterity
-
Battery Life: About 3 hours of active operation
-
Primary Use: Industrial automation and assembly
8. Figure AI – Figure 02
Figure 02 by Figure AI represents the integration of advanced AI and humanoid design. This robot is optimized for handling industrial workflows and complex manipulation tasks.
Overview: Figure 02 offers a sleek design with integrated vision and dexterous manipulation capabilities. It is designed to perform tasks that require both precision and endurance, making it a key player in modern manufacturing environments.
Key Metrics:
-
Height: Approximately 1.7 m
-
Weight: Around 60 kg (estimated)
-
Hand Dexterity: Five-fingered hands with 16 degrees of freedom
-
Load Capacity: Up to 25 kg
-
Vision System: Equipped with six RGB cameras and advanced processing capabilities
9. Sanctuary AI – Phoenix
Phoenix by Sanctuary AI is a cutting-edge humanoid that combines human-like behavior with sophisticated automation. Phoenix is designed for natural human interaction while performing complex tasks.
Overview: Focused on human-robot interaction, Phoenix’s AI system allows it to understand and respond to human cues, making it ideal for collaborative work and service-oriented environments.
Key Metrics:
-
Height: Approximately 1.65 m
-
Weight: Around 55 kg
-
Degrees of Freedom: 30+ joints for smooth movement
-
Battery Life: Around 4 hours per charge
-
Unique Feature: Advanced cognitive AI for realistic human interaction
10. Engineered Arts – Ameca
Ameca, developed by Engineered Arts, is known for its lifelike facial expressions and human-like interactions. Often featured in media and demonstrations, Ameca is redefining social robotics.
Overview: Ameca is designed with human-like communication in mind, boasting over 50 facial expressions and fluid body movements. It’s perfect for customer service, education, and entertainment, offering a glimpse into the future of human-robot collaboration.
Key Metrics:
-
Height: Approximately 1.7 m
-
Facial Expressions: Over 50 lifelike expressions
-
Degrees of Freedom: More than 20 joints for facial and body movements
-
Primary Use: Social interaction, customer service
-
Interaction: Advanced voice and conversational AI
11. DEEP Robotics – Dr01
Dr01 from DEEP Robotics is a robust humanoid robot designed for industrial precision and durability. Built to meet the challenges of modern manufacturing and quality control, it offers high-performance operations.
Overview: Dr01 is equipped with advanced sensors that monitor and adjust in real time, ensuring precision in tasks. Its rugged design guarantees reliability in demanding environments.
Key Metrics:
-
Height: Approximately 1.6 m (estimated)
-
Weight: Around 65 kg (estimated)
-
Design Focus: Robust construction and precision tasks
-
Primary Use: Manufacturing, quality control, and industrial automation
-
Advanced Sensors: Integrated for continuous monitoring
12. Robot Era – STAR 1
Robot Era’s STAR 1 is a versatile humanoid robot designed to demonstrate the future of interactive robotics. Its modular design and advanced locomotion make it ideal for a variety of applications.
Overview: STAR 1 is designed to be flexible and easily reconfigurable, making it suitable for demonstrations and practical deployments across industries. Its advanced motion planning allows it to perform human-like movements with precision.
Key Metrics:
-
Height: Approximately 1.7 m (estimated)
-
Weight: Around 60 kg (estimated)
-
Modular Design: For easy reconfiguration and upgrades
-
Primary Use: Demonstrations, interactive applications, light industrial tasks
-
Advanced Locomotion: State-of-the-art motion planning technology
These 12 humanoid robots represent a glimpse into the future of robotics, offering a diverse array of functionalities and capabilities to revolutionize industries, enhance human-robot interaction, and improve daily life.
